-
Notifications
You must be signed in to change notification settings - Fork 0
/
LeetCode_595_Big Countries.sql
executable file
·40 lines (28 loc) · 2.18 KB
/
LeetCode_595_Big Countries.sql
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
Create table If Not Exists World (name varchar(255), continent varchar(255), area int, population int, gdp int)
Truncate table World
insert into World (name, continent, area, population, gdp) values ('Afghanistan', 'Asia', '652230', '25500100', '20343000000')
insert into World (name, continent, area, population, gdp) values ('Albania', 'Europe', '28748', '2831741', '12960000000')
insert into World (name, continent, area, population, gdp) values ('Algeria', 'Africa', '2381741', '37100000', '188681000000')
insert into World (name, continent, area, population, gdp) values ('Andorra', 'Europe', '468', '78115', '3712000000')
insert into World (name, continent, area, population, gdp) values ('Angola', 'Africa', '1246700', '20609294', '100990000000')
-- There is a table World
-- +-----------------+------------+------------+--------------+---------------+
-- | name | continent | area | population | gdp |
-- +-----------------+------------+------------+--------------+---------------+
-- | Afghanistan | Asia | 652230 | 25500100 | 20343000 |
-- | Albania | Europe | 28748 | 2831741 | 12960000 |
-- | Algeria | Africa | 2381741 | 37100000 | 188681000 |
-- | Andorra | Europe | 468 | 78115 | 3712000 |
-- | Angola | Africa | 1246700 | 20609294 | 100990000 |
-- +-----------------+------------+------------+--------------+---------------+
-- A country is big if it has an area of bigger than 3 million square km or a population of more than 25 million.
-- Write a SQL solution to output big countries' name, population and area.
-- For example, according to the above table, we should output:
-- +--------------+-------------+--------------+
-- | name | population | area |
-- +--------------+-------------+--------------+
-- | Afghanistan | 25500100 | 652230 |
-- | Algeria | 37100000 | 2381741 |
-- +--------------+-------------+--------------+
-- Write your MySQL query statement below
select name, population, area from World where area > 3000000 or population > 25000000